I really want to make a Sorcerer/Dragon Disciple and get the Disciple to level 10, but I'm worried about my spells being to weak.

Can Sorcerer 10/Dragon Disciple 10 at level 20 still be effective?

If not what, levels of each do you recommend?
UMiskatonic

09-10-05, 04:51 PM
Um, no. You will not be as effective as a 20th level caster should be, nor will you be as powerful as a 20th level melee tank. You will be bad at both, and get crushed.

If you want a draconic feel, consider the draconic feats from Complete Arcane. Or play a kobold sorceror. Or both. Have a pseudo-dragon familiar, or learn the draconic polymorph spell.

Even the half-dragon template is a better choice. It allows most of the benefits of being a dragon, and only costs three levels, not 10.

If you are committed to dragon disciple, then you'll be far happier with something like paladin 5/sorceror 1/dragon disciple 10/cavalier 6, or something along those lines. Talk to your DM about getting a dragon to ride around on.

Despite the deceptive pre-reqs, Dragon Disciple is a very melee-oriented class. The best ways to enter into it are Hexblade, Fighter/Bard, and Paladin/Sorc/EK.
